I first saw her ceramics in Roslyn, my favorite coffee shop in London. And of course I have her coffee mug at home for my every morning coffee:) I searched her instagram and found out she’s doing classes. The course is structured by 3 sessions, each for up to an hour. Usually it will be done in pairs (as there’s two wheels in her cosy studio), and if you apply single, you will be paired up. However I was lucky enough to take the course alone. I have took several ceramics classes, but it was THE BEST class I took! You will learn the techniques, as she will take you through step by step, but also you get the freedom to try by yourself (and she is always there to correct in case something goes wrong). I particularly like her glazes as the colours are all very gentle and beautiful, yet was surprised to find out that she’s making the glazes by her self! In the glazing session, you will get to chose the colours and the patterns. I have made 5 plates and mugs, which all turned out beautifully and I really enjoyed the session!! It’s only 3 classes so no huge commitment, and highly recommend if you are interested in pottery or planning to start something new as a New Years resolution!!
